From 54ef1411a5982546f52dbe80189b7b6c0076e513 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Konstantin=20Gru=CC=88ndger?= Date: Mon, 18 Mar 2019 22:48:42 +0100 Subject: [PATCH] fix delete query --- ogn_python/collect/celery.py |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-) diff --git a/ogn_python/collect/celery.py b/ogn_python/collect/celery.py index 1d22b9d..d940240 100644 --- a/ogn_python/collect/celery.py +++ b/ogn_python/collect/celery.py @@ -61,10 +61,12 @@ def purge_old_data(max_hours): from ogn_python.model import AircraftBeacon, ReceiverBeacon min_timestamp = datetime.datetime.utcnow() - datetime.timedelta(hours=max_hours) - db.session(AircraftBeacon) \ + db.session.query(AircraftBeacon) \ .filter(AircraftBeacon.timestamp < min_timestamp) \ .delete() - db.session(ReceiverBeacon) \ + db.session.query(ReceiverBeacon) \ .filter(ReceiverBeacon.timestamp < min_timestamp) \ .delete() + + db.session.commit() \ No newline at end of file